swelling around my optic nerve
 
First of all, I'm new to this forum so hello to everyone ! I have been having headace's, blurred vision, disorientation, nausea, forgetfulness and so my dr. sent me to have an MRI, an eye exam and to the neurologist. The eye dr. was first and he found that I have swelling around my optic nerve. It kinda scares me to think what could be causeing the swelling. Has anyone ever had this?

I have had optic nerve swelling
 
Hi, I am a newbie here too. So strange, I have found many intesting questions and answers in the last hour, than I have in a very long time surfing the net about fms. anyway... you were asking if anyone has had optic nerve swelling. I had cancer (don't let that scare you) and had a thyroidectomy where they took out all of my thyroid... and soon after that I started getting the same symptoms you were describing. I was sent to a eye doctor who told me that it was because I was overweight and I must have gained a lot suddenly and so forth. I did not believe a word he said cause it was not true. He even went on to say that I could go blind at any minute.... for the next three months I hardly slept at all... I just stared at my 8 year old daughter while she slept trying to burn her image into my mind.... it was awful. They finally gave me this medication that makes your feet and your hands feel like they are asleep for long periods of time.... and they were very insistant that I walk and watch my diet. I did not do the latter two. They had me coming in for different tests weekly... and one day I was all better... just like that. That is all I really know... wish I could tell you more ... but you may have enough info to ask the doctor if you have fluid behind your eyes?
